expression, noun-modifying (irregular)
Prenominal phrase meaning 'well-known' or 'famous', used to modify nouns. Derived from the expression 名が通る (to be well-known).
See also: 名が通る
彼は名の通った作家だ。
He is a well-known writer.
この店は地元で名の通ったラーメン屋です。
This shop is a locally famous ramen place.
The base expression meaning 'to be well-known'; 名の通った is its prenominal form.
A more common and versatile adjective meaning 'famous'; 名の通った is slightly more literary and often implies established reputation.
Fixed prenominal form of the expression 名が通る (name passes through → to be well-known).
